European Boatbuilder METS 2006 Technology Forum - Schedule at a Glance
Tuesday 14 th November - Composite Processes and Materials
12.00 - 13.00 
Session 1
Setting the Scene: The Future of Composites in the Marine Industry  
Ed Findon, VT Halmatic,
Nick Partington, Gurit/SP
 
13.00 - 14.00           
Session 2
Cost Reduction and Efficiency Innovations in Single Skin Construction
Scott Lewit, Structural Composites
Thomas Anmarkrud of OS Boat, Norway
 
14.00 - 15.00
Improving Cosmetics and Surface Quality in Composite Construction  
Michael Eaglen, High Modulus ,
Edwin van Herpt, Lightweight Structures
 
15:00 - 16:00 
Time & Cost Savings with New Resin Infusion Materials & Techniques
Philip Lunn, Airtech
 
16:00 - 17:30
Real Life Resin Infusion
Richard Watson, VT Halmatic,
Neil Chaplin, Royal National Lifeboat Institution (RNLI)
 
Wednesday 15th November - Manufacturing Management and Technology
12.00 - 13.00
The Marine Industry Goes Lean
Steve Boam, KM&T Ltd.
 
13.00 - 14.00
New MRP Management System Yields Efficiencies at Numarine
Erdal Kilic, Numarine
 
14.00 - 15.00
From Computer to Large Scale Models with the Help of CNC Technology
Chris Edwards, Delcam,
Mateo Sardo, CMS
 
15.00 - 16.00
Rapid Production of Patterns & Moulds for Production Boatbuilders
Andy Harvey,
Gurit/SP
 
16:00 - 17:00
The Clever Way to Infuse Large Parts
Arjen Koorevaar, Polyworx
